Can you swim in the beaches in Cancun?
Cancun and the area to the south, the Riviera Maya, is home to some 150 miles of beach. It is important for visitors to always pay attention to flags on the beach, which indicate water conditions.A green flag means that it’s completely safe to swim.
Is it safe to swim in the sea in Cancun?
The waters along the north side of Cancun’s 7-shaped island are generally safer for non-swimmers and weak swimmers. The beaches on the east side have rougher surf and can be more dangerous. Sometimes the undertow can be very strong and people can be pulled out or to the south quicker than they expect.

Are there alligators or crocodiles in Cancun?
No alligators. Crocodiles, yes, though. There are crocs in the lagoon by the restaurants, also in the mangroves if you take the jungle tour to the reef as well as in Crococun Zoo south of the hotel zone. Also, if you golf, the crocs can sometimes be found on the courses.
Is the Ocean warm in Cancun?
Cancun water temperatures are always bathtub warm, varying from 78°F-80°F in the winter months to 82°F-84°F in the summer months. Underwater visibility is best near Cozumel, where it can reach up to an amazing 200 feet.
Is the water in Cancun rough?
Generally, the waters along the long side of the ‘7’ of the Hotel Zone of Cancun are rough. If oceanside activities like you mention are your primary goal, then Cancun should not be your destination.

Can you swim in December in Cancun?
Yes!
In december, swimming is ideal on the beaches around Cancun! With water reaching 82°F at most and 80°F on average, spending time in the water is very pleasant. Note also that in december, the climate is good with an average outside temperature of 78°F, 2.5in of precipitation (over 13 days) and 79.56 % humidity.

What is the coldest month in Cancun Mexico?
January
The coldest month of the year in Cancún is January, with an average low of 67°F and high of 81°F.
